2010-10-08 7 views
1

Je dois copier des fichiers, créer un nouveau dossier, puis coller ces fichiers dans le nouveau dossier si souvent.Grouper le fichier dans le nouveau dossier?

Je me demande si nous pouvons faire un fichier batch ou un fichier vbscript pour effectuer cette tâche? Sélectionnez simplement les fichiers et choisissez "Group to New Folder" dans le menu contextuel. Ce sera génial!

+0

BTW, j'ai trouvé une solution dans .NET 4.0 http://blogs.msdn.com/b/codefx/archive/ 2010/09/14/écriture-windows-shell-extension-avec-net-framework-4-c-vb-net-partie-1.aspx – ByulTaeng

Répondre

0

Ce que vous voulez faire est d'écrire une application HTA. Vous pouvez avoir une liste de sélection qui peut être automatiquement remplie avec les fichiers de dossiers en cours lorsque vous lancez le hta. Ensuite, il suffit d'un simple bouton qui vous demandera de créer un dossier/nom de dossier quand il est sélectionné et un sous simple pour simplement déplacer les fichiers sélectionnés, peut-être à travers les résultats à l'écran ou quelque chose. Évidemment, avec le piégeage des erreurs et tout ce qui est un petit peu de code à coller ici, mais il devrait être assez facile à faire. Si vous cherchez de l'aide pour commencer avec l'interface hta, je vous recommande de consulter le "HTA Helpomatic" que vous pouvez utiliser pour obtenir l'interface graphique de base, ainsi que le code de la boîte de sélection. Évidemment, vous pouvez écrire les sous-scripts pour faire le vrai travail.

Questions connexes